What are the responsibilities and job description for the DevSecOps Engineers (2) position at Method360?
Title: DevSecOps Engineer
Location: Remote/Ohio
Start Date: 4/21/2025
Duration: 6 month
Responsibilities:
Location: Remote/Ohio
Start Date: 4/21/2025
Duration: 6 month
Responsibilities:
- Drive DevOps acceleration by enhancing or creating Azure DevOps (ADO) pipelines for CI/CD automation and scalability.
- Implement Infrastructure as Code (IaC) and CI/CD strategies where none currently exist.
- Develop IaC environments using Terraform, integrating with the MPC IaC Turbo framework to streamline infrastructure deployment.
- Enhance code quality and security by leveraging Snyk and SonarQube for vulnerability detection, static code analysis, quality gates, and compliance enforcement.
- Collaborate across four key teams - FinOps, DevSecOps, IaC, and Software Engineering - requiring strong communication, cross-functional teamwork, and technical leadership.
- Utilize Identity Access Management (IAM) principles, processes, and systems to improve security of resources.
- Azure DevOps Management and Usage
- Azure DevOps Pipeline Development/Design (i.e., YAML)
- Programming/Scripting (to support pipeline build/test activities, as well as automation)
- Software Testing (i.e., unit testing, quality testing, functional testing, load testing)
- Application/Pipeline Debugging
- Infrastructure as Code (IaC)
- Version Control Management (i.e., git)
- Agile Methodologies (i.e., SAFE, Scrum)
- Experience with SonarQube or other code quality tooling
- Experience with Snyk or other AppSec vulnerability tooling
- Octopus deploy administration and configuration
- Application containerization using Docker/Kubernetes
- Experience with Azure PaaS/IaaS
- Infrastructure-As-Code Experience - Terraform